The Taboos of White Chrysanthemum
Although white chrysanthemum tea is beneficial, it should not be consumed excessively. Since white chrysanthemum has a cold nature, people with a deficiency in the spleen and stomach should drink less or none at all. Those with a yang deficiency constitution may experience the opposite effect if they try to reduce heat and clear heat by drinking white chrysanthemum tea, which can damage their vital energy and make them feel weaker. Therefore, drinking white chrysanthemum tea excessively is not a good habit, especially for those with a deficiency in the spleen and stomach, as drinking too much of the cooling tea can easily cause stomach discomfort or even stomach acid.

Generally, brewing white chrysanthemum tea is a very simple and convenient method. Prepare equal amounts of white chrysanthemum and rock sugar and place them together in a clean cup, then pour boiling water over them. After about three minutes, you can remove the lid and drink.
